]>
xenbits.xensource.com Git - osstest.git/log
Ian Jackson [Fri, 15 Feb 2013 14:50:29 +0000 (14:50 +0000)]
visible-undef: use on Ehter in guest_await_dhcp_tcp
Ian Jackson [Fri, 15 Feb 2013 14:49:46 +0000 (14:49 +0000)]
visible-undef: new internal function
Ian Jackson [Fri, 15 Feb 2013 14:47:02 +0000 (14:47 +0000)]
Post-merge fixes, dealing with a few undefs
Ian Jackson [Fri, 15 Feb 2013 11:35:25 +0000 (11:35 +0000)]
DhcpWatch: include various missing bits in leases.pm
Ian Jackson [Thu, 14 Feb 2013 19:31:24 +0000 (19:31 +0000)]
Executive: fix up sharing check
Reinstates
7b69d0fac4912f077c5ecc53088b0272d9a6b0bb
which was lost during the merge
Ian Jackson [Thu, 14 Feb 2013 19:24:35 +0000 (19:24 +0000)]
Executive: sharing safety catch dumps more info
Ian Jackson [Thu, 14 Feb 2013 18:51:53 +0000 (18:51 +0000)]
pdu: rename power_state method to pdu_power_state to avoid clash with TestSupport's function, fix msw too
Ian Jackson [Thu, 14 Feb 2013 18:42:49 +0000 (18:42 +0000)]
pdu: rename power_state method to pdu_power_state to avoid clash with TestSupport's function
Ian Jackson [Thu, 14 Feb 2013 17:04:39 +0000 (17:04 +0000)]
config: production fixes
Ian Jackson [Thu, 14 Feb 2013 16:35:45 +0000 (16:35 +0000)]
config: wip fix tftp
Ian Jackson [Thu, 14 Feb 2013 16:23:05 +0000 (16:23 +0000)]
config: support :-separated lists of config files
Ian Jackson [Thu, 14 Feb 2013 16:17:54 +0000 (16:17 +0000)]
Executive: more fixes
Ian Jackson [Thu, 14 Feb 2013 16:04:05 +0000 (16:04 +0000)]
power: refuse to set power state for shared hosts (fix)
Ian Jackson [Thu, 14 Feb 2013 16:01:01 +0000 (16:01 +0000)]
power: refuse to set power state for shared hosts
Ian Jackson [Thu, 14 Feb 2013 16:00:46 +0000 (16:00 +0000)]
Osstest::PDU::statedb: fix method
Ian Jackson [Thu, 14 Feb 2013 15:50:57 +0000 (15:50 +0000)]
make-flight: fix ref to old Suite config var
Ian Jackson [Thu, 14 Feb 2013 15:49:08 +0000 (15:49 +0000)]
sg-run-job: fix logs capture logic
Ian Jackson [Thu, 14 Feb 2013 15:48:18 +0000 (15:48 +0000)]
sympathy: fix msg
Ian Jackson [Thu, 14 Feb 2013 15:29:48 +0000 (15:29 +0000)]
Executive: more fixes
Ian Jackson [Thu, 14 Feb 2013 15:20:38 +0000 (15:20 +0000)]
Executive: more fixes
Ian Jackson [Thu, 14 Feb 2013 15:17:30 +0000 (15:17 +0000)]
Executive: more fixes
Ian Jackson [Thu, 14 Feb 2013 15:14:27 +0000 (15:14 +0000)]
Executive: more fixes
Ian Jackson [Thu, 14 Feb 2013 15:00:34 +0000 (15:00 +0000)]
PDU: provide explicit "unsupported" method
Ian Jackson [Thu, 14 Feb 2013 14:48:18 +0000 (14:48 +0000)]
sg-report-flight: avoid an undefined ref
Ian Jackson [Thu, 14 Feb 2013 14:40:35 +0000 (14:40 +0000)]
Executive: more fixes
Ian Jackson [Thu, 14 Feb 2013 14:35:37 +0000 (14:35 +0000)]
Executive: support OSSTEST_TCL_JOBDB_DEBUG - fix db-execute-array really
Ian Jackson [Thu, 14 Feb 2013 14:34:58 +0000 (14:34 +0000)]
Executive: support OSSTEST_TCL_JOBDB_DEBUG - fix db-execute-array
Ian Jackson [Thu, 14 Feb 2013 14:31:48 +0000 (14:31 +0000)]
Executive: support OSSTEST_TCL_JOBDB_DEBUG - fix
Ian Jackson [Thu, 14 Feb 2013 14:29:08 +0000 (14:29 +0000)]
sg-run-job: do not try to allocate no hosts (fixes builds)
Ian Jackson [Thu, 14 Feb 2013 14:23:33 +0000 (14:23 +0000)]
Executive: support OSSTEST_TCL_JOBDB_DEBUG (abstracting away all calls to pg_execute)
Ian Jackson [Thu, 14 Feb 2013 14:07:47 +0000 (14:07 +0000)]
Executive: provisional step testid is STARTING not TBD
Ian Jackson [Thu, 14 Feb 2013 14:07:10 +0000 (14:07 +0000)]
sg-report-flight: check for unjustifiability of a failure before checking whether it ever passed; avoids erroneous push!
Ian Jackson [Thu, 14 Feb 2013 13:08:41 +0000 (13:08 +0000)]
Executive: fixes following merge/reorg
Ian Jackson [Thu, 14 Feb 2013 13:08:22 +0000 (13:08 +0000)]
host allocation: eliminate an undefined print
Ian Jackson [Thu, 14 Feb 2013 12:57:50 +0000 (12:57 +0000)]
tcl: fixes following merge/reorg
Ian Jackson [Thu, 14 Feb 2013 12:55:56 +0000 (12:55 +0000)]
tcl: fixes following merge/reorg
Ian Jackson [Thu, 14 Feb 2013 12:50:12 +0000 (12:50 +0000)]
tcl: fixes following merge/reorg
Ian Jackson [Thu, 14 Feb 2013 12:48:57 +0000 (12:48 +0000)]
tcl: fixes following merge/reorg
Ian Jackson [Thu, 14 Feb 2013 12:41:53 +0000 (12:41 +0000)]
tcl: do not keep db connection open while step is running
Ian Jackson [Thu, 14 Feb 2013 12:41:25 +0000 (12:41 +0000)]
tcl: fixes following merge/reorg
Ian Jackson [Thu, 14 Feb 2013 12:40:17 +0000 (12:40 +0000)]
Executive: provide db_pg_dsn (for the benefit of Tcl)
Ian Jackson [Thu, 14 Feb 2013 12:08:40 +0000 (12:08 +0000)]
Executive: fixes following merge/reorg
Ian Jackson [Thu, 14 Feb 2013 11:59:12 +0000 (11:59 +0000)]
Executive: fixes following merge/reorg
Ian Jackson [Thu, 14 Feb 2013 11:52:40 +0000 (11:52 +0000)]
Executive: fixes following merge/reorg
Ian Jackson [Thu, 14 Feb 2013 11:49:18 +0000 (11:49 +0000)]
Executive: fixes following merge/reorg
Ian Jackson [Thu, 14 Feb 2013 11:47:01 +0000 (11:47 +0000)]
jobdb_check_other_job: extra $why parameter
Ian Jackson [Thu, 14 Feb 2013 11:46:42 +0000 (11:46 +0000)]
Executive: fixes following merge/reorg
Ian Jackson [Thu, 14 Feb 2013 11:45:02 +0000 (11:45 +0000)]
Osstest: fix config file reader handling of here docs
Ian Jackson [Thu, 14 Feb 2013 11:19:14 +0000 (11:19 +0000)]
cri-args-hostlists: honour OSSTEST_IGNORE_STOP
Ian Jackson [Wed, 13 Feb 2013 14:01:00 +0000 (14:01 +0000)]
Merge branch 'wip.interfaces'
Ian Jackson [Tue, 12 Feb 2013 19:07:17 +0000 (19:07 +0000)]
sg-report-flight: do not write to MRO for recursive flights, so we avoid writing "tolerable" when it's not
Ian Jackson [Tue, 12 Feb 2013 15:22:10 +0000 (15:22 +0000)]
sg-report-flight: prefer to reference flights with lexically early blessings (prefer "real" over "real-bisect")
Ian Jackson [Tue, 12 Feb 2013 11:47:58 +0000 (11:47 +0000)]
empty commit to force push gate test
Ian Jackson [Fri, 8 Feb 2013 12:44:11 +0000 (12:44 +0000)]
Revert "ocaml: install ocaml-nox (build, test) and ocaml-findlib (build only)"
This reverts commit
bbc714a1a1c4ec046acc6f93a2877fe3253fa185 .
Ian Jackson [Thu, 7 Feb 2013 11:36:16 +0000 (11:36 +0000)]
Merge remote branch 'remotes/service/pretest'
Ian Jackson [Wed, 6 Feb 2013 12:41:31 +0000 (12:41 +0000)]
Merge branch 'wip.interfaces' of mariner.not:/u/iwj/work/testing into wip.interfaces
Ian Jackson [Wed, 6 Feb 2013 12:41:00 +0000 (12:41 +0000)]
all files: add copyright notices
Signed-off-by: Ian Jackson <Ian.Jackson@eu.citrix.com>
Ian Jackson [Wed, 6 Feb 2013 12:23:26 +0000 (12:23 +0000)]
COPYING: Provide a copyright licence
Use the AGPLv3.
There are currently no commits in the tree for which we don't own the
copyright, so we can do this. Authorship for past commits is me other
than where explicitly stated.
Signed-off-by: Ian Jackson <Ian.Jackson@eu.citrix.com>
Ian Jackson [Wed, 6 Feb 2013 12:15:34 +0000 (12:15 +0000)]
ts-host-install, Debian: improvements for standalone mode
Add a per-host option to not use serial, in case the test box only
has VGA.
Also allow the user to configure which Debian Installer frontend to
use, again useful in standalone mode (where you might actually be
watching it)
Signed-off-by: Ian Campbell <ian.campbell@citrix.com>
Ian Jackson [Wed, 6 Feb 2013 12:12:21 +0000 (12:12 +0000)]
Debian: Wheezy compatible preseed
Keyboard configuration preseed has changed in wheezy, use
keyboard-configuration/xkb-keymap (wheezy) as well as
console-keymaps-at/keymap (pre-wheezy).
Signed-off-by: Ian Campbell <ian.campbell@citrix.com>
Ian Jackson [Wed, 6 Feb 2013 12:04:43 +0000 (12:04 +0000)]
Merge branch 'pretest' into wip.interfaces
Ian Jackson [Wed, 15 Feb 2012 15:01:30 +0000 (15:01 +0000)]
ocaml: capture /var/run/xenstored and do not care about leaks of /var/run/xenstored/db{,.debug}
Ian Jackson [Fri, 10 Feb 2012 11:27:22 +0000 (11:27 +0000)]
ocaml: install ocaml-nox (build, test) and ocaml-findlib (build only)
Ian Jackson [Tue, 5 Feb 2013 18:22:57 +0000 (18:22 +0000)]
ts-xen-install: Run ldconfig after install
This appears to be needed when libraries are outside /lib and /usr/lib
(specifically when they are in /usr/local/lib)
Signed-off-by: Ian Campbell <ian.campbell@citrix.com>
Ian Jackson [Mon, 4 Feb 2013 15:31:11 +0000 (15:31 +0000)]
sg-report-flight: find bisection flights in findaflight, so we can reuse info from the bisector
Ian Jackson [Mon, 4 Feb 2013 15:30:51 +0000 (15:30 +0000)]
sg-report-flight: findaflight can chase build job references as found in bisection flights
Ian Jackson [Mon, 4 Feb 2013 15:29:33 +0000 (15:29 +0000)]
sg-report-flight: propagate flight blessing's -suffix, if any, to reports (appending it to the flight num ber)
Ian Jackson [Thu, 31 Jan 2013 17:31:50 +0000 (17:31 +0000)]
README and TODO items from Ian Campbell
Ian Jackson [Thu, 31 Jan 2013 17:25:35 +0000 (17:25 +0000)]
ts-debian-install: set guest password to "xenroot"
Ian Jackson [Thu, 31 Jan 2013 17:23:06 +0000 (17:23 +0000)]
TODO: remove obsolete file
Ian Jackson [Thu, 31 Jan 2013 17:21:46 +0000 (17:21 +0000)]
Merge remote branch 'remotes/play/wip.interfaces' into wip.interfaces
Ian Jackson [Thu, 31 Jan 2013 17:21:10 +0000 (17:21 +0000)]
Merge remote branch 'remotes/service/incoming' into wip.interfaces
Conflicts:
Osstest.pm
ts-hosts-allocate
ts-xen-build-prep
Ian Jackson [Thu, 31 Jan 2013 12:26:27 +0000 (12:26 +0000)]
bisection: use sg-report-flight's basis as the basis if we can't find one ourselves
Ian Jackson [Thu, 31 Jan 2013 11:38:05 +0000 (11:38 +0000)]
cs-bisection-step: allow -bisect blessed flights for basis pass
Ian Jackson [Thu, 31 Jan 2013 11:24:48 +0000 (11:24 +0000)]
cs-job-create: OSSTEST_JOBS_ONLY is :-separated list of regexps
Ian Jackson [Mon, 28 Jan 2013 18:04:32 +0000 (18:04 +0000)]
make-flight: add build-armhf job
Ian Jackson [Mon, 28 Jan 2013 18:04:19 +0000 (18:04 +0000)]
host props: support "homedir"
Ian Jackson [Mon, 28 Jan 2013 18:04:05 +0000 (18:04 +0000)]
host props: support "no-reinstall" flag, which means we don't necessarily get Ether and Power, and ts-host-install and ts-xen-build-prep are noops
Ian Jackson [Mon, 28 Jan 2013 18:02:52 +0000 (18:02 +0000)]
selecthost: move up the querying of host flags, so they can influence the Ether etc.
Ian Jackson [Mon, 28 Jan 2013 18:00:21 +0000 (18:00 +0000)]
host props: support "fqdn"
Ian Jackson [Fri, 25 Jan 2013 12:14:58 +0000 (12:14 +0000)]
ts-xen-build: pass --sysconfdir=/etc to configure
Ian Jackson [Fri, 25 Jan 2013 12:14:41 +0000 (12:14 +0000)]
ts-xen-install: bomb out of after installation we find things in /usr/local/var or /usr/local/etc, apart from (temporarily) an exception for /usr/local/etc/qemu
Ian Jackson [Thu, 29 Nov 2012 11:29:47 +0000 (11:29 +0000)]
ts-xen-build-prep: install cmake too for the benefit of vtpm
Ian Jackson [Fri, 23 Nov 2012 12:32:56 +0000 (12:32 +0000)]
make-flight: add -qemut tests for qemu-xen-traditional
Ian Jackson [Wed, 21 Nov 2012 14:49:25 +0000 (14:49 +0000)]
ts-xen-*: install libpixman too as this is a dep for upstream qemu
Ian Jackson [Tue, 6 Nov 2012 10:32:52 +0000 (10:32 +0000)]
Osstest: selecthost: include harness rev in share type check
Ian Jackson [Wed, 31 Oct 2012 16:06:45 +0000 (16:06 +0000)]
standalone: README: document DebianNonfreeFirmware
Ian Jackson [Wed, 31 Oct 2012 11:50:04 +0000 (11:50 +0000)]
Osstest: resource_shared_mark_ready: include harness rev in mark ready check
Ian Jackson [Tue, 30 Oct 2012 16:42:24 +0000 (16:42 +0000)]
Osstest: resource_shared_mark_ready: prod the queue daemon
Ian Jackson [Tue, 30 Oct 2012 16:34:12 +0000 (16:34 +0000)]
ts-hosts-allocate: add harness rev to sharetype
Ian Jackson [Tue, 30 Oct 2012 14:08:11 +0000 (14:08 +0000)]
cr-for-branches: reduce inter-branch sleep
Ian Jackson [Tue, 30 Oct 2012 14:05:26 +0000 (14:05 +0000)]
crontab: run bisects really 4 times per hour
Ian Jackson [Wed, 31 Oct 2012 12:28:31 +0000 (12:28 +0000)]
cs-bisection-step: check old stash still exists, properly
Ian Jackson [Wed, 31 Oct 2012 11:59:46 +0000 (11:59 +0000)]
cs-bisection-step: check old stash still exists
Ian Jackson [Fri, 26 Oct 2012 15:26:39 +0000 (16:26 +0100)]
mg-hosts: new subcommand previoustasks
Ian Jackson [Thu, 18 Oct 2012 17:19:34 +0000 (18:19 +0100)]
wip reorg new style pxe
Ian Jackson [Thu, 18 Oct 2012 15:13:56 +0000 (16:13 +0100)]
wip reorg wip make Ether optional
Ian Jackson [Thu, 18 Oct 2012 15:13:45 +0000 (16:13 +0100)]
wip reorg refactor Properties
Ian Jackson [Thu, 18 Oct 2012 14:53:51 +0000 (15:53 +0100)]
wip reorg fixes
Ian Jackson [Thu, 18 Oct 2012 14:40:56 +0000 (15:40 +0100)]
ts-debian-install guess better defaults for xen_kernel_{path,ver}